Backgrounder. MENA is much more complicated than it portrayed in the West. The reasons that the West is there at all are oil and gas, and Israel.

Lobelog
Libya’s Role in the Polarized Sunni World

Giorgio Cafiero, CEO and founder of Gulf State Analyticsa Washington, DC-based geopolitical risk consultancy, and Elaine Miao, contributor to Gulf State Analytics
